Pricing Analysis

Price comparison per million tokens

Gemini 2.0 Flash-Lite costs less

For input processing, Gemini 2.0 Flash-Lite ($0.07/1M tokens) is 4.3x cheaper than Gemini 3.5 Flash-Lite ($0.30/1M tokens).

For output processing, Gemini 2.0 Flash-Lite ($0.30/1M tokens) is 8.3x cheaper than Gemini 3.5 Flash-Lite ($2.50/1M tokens).

In conclusion, Gemini 3.5 Flash-Lite is more expensive than Gemini 2.0 Flash-Lite.*

* Using a 3:1 ratio of input to output tokens

Context Window

Maximum input and output token capacity

Both models have the same input context window of 1,048,576 tokens. Gemini 3.5 Flash-Lite can generate longer responses up to 65,536 tokens, while Gemini 2.0 Flash-Lite is limited to 8,192 tokens.

Knowledge Cutoff

When training data ends

Gemini 2.0 Flash-Lite has a knowledge cutoff of 2024-06-01, while Gemini 3.5 Flash-Lite has a cutoff of 2026-03-31.

Gemini 3.5 Flash-Lite has more recent training data (up to 2026-03-31), making it potentially better informed about events through that date compared to Gemini 2.0 Flash-Lite (2024-06-01).

How does Gemini 2.0 Flash-Lite compare to Gemini 3.5 Flash-Lite in benchmarks?

Gemini 2.0 Flash-Lite scores MATH: 86.8%, FACTS Grounding: 83.6%, Global-MMLU-Lite: 78.2%, MMLU-Pro: 71.6%, MMMU: 68.0%. Gemini 3.5 Flash-Lite scores CharXiv-R: 76.5%, OSWorld-Verified: 74.0%, SWE-Bench Pro: 54.2%, Terminal-Bench 2.1: 54.0%, MLE-Bench: 39.2%.
